Vermont State Police are investigating after a Burlington police officer shot at the driver of a motor vehicle early Sunday morning.
The shooting followed a report of a disturbance around 12:40 a.m. Sunday. Responding Burlington officers were searching for a vehicle in connection with the initial call and found it in the area of 16 Prospect Hill.

During the interaction, one Burlington police officer fired his duty weapon. No injuries were reported.
The circumstances of the shooting remain under investigation by members of the state police Major Crime Unit.
